Signs a Tree Might Need to Come Down
Large dead branches or a dead crown
Dead limbs fall without warning. If more than a quarter of the canopy is dead, the whole tree is usually a safety problem.
Cracks in the trunk or major limbs
Vertical cracks, split forks, or heavy lean after a storm are warning signs a tree is no longer structurally sound.
Visible root damage or fungal growth
Mushrooms at the base, rotted roots, or a trunk that's hollow at the bottom point to decay you can't see from the canopy.
Tree is too close to your house or power lines
Proximity alone isn't always a removal reason, but if the tree is damaged AND close to a structure, waiting is the expensive choice.
Storm damage you can't repair with pruning
If major scaffold limbs are gone and the remaining structure is unbalanced, removal is often safer than hoping it grows back.

Our Tree Removal Process
- 1
Free on-site estimate
We walk the property, assess the tree, talk through your goals, and give you a flat-rate quote.
- 2
Schedule the work
We coordinate around your schedule, utility locates if needed, and any permits specific to your municipality.
- 3
Protect the site
Tarps, plywood, and rigging points go in place before any cuts. Landscaping and hardscape get covered.
- 4
Controlled removal
Bucket truck or climb-and-rig, depending on the tree and the drop zone. Every major limb is lowered, not dropped.
- 5
Cleanup and haul-off
Chips, brush, and logs are loaded out. You get your yard back the same day in most cases.
